Pisarzhevskii Institute Of Physical Chemistry of The National Academy of Sciences of Ukraine popup.description1 The aim of this work is to develop the physicochemical basis for the creation of catalysts based on the latest carbon nanomaterials, in particular, CNTs and graphene, and composites based on them for heterogeneous-catalytic processes of obtaining valuable chemical compounds, which, in particular, will contribute to the expansion of the use of such carbon nanomaterials catalysts for industrially important heterogeneous catalytic processes: hydrogenation of organic compounds, hydrogenation of carbon monoxide, acid-base transformations of mono- and polyhydric alcohols s with obtaining valuable products such as olefins, heavy waxes, oils, motor fuel components, glycerol esters, carbonyl compounds. To achieve this goal, methods for the synthesis of simple and functionalized carbon nanotubes, graphene and nanocomposites will be developed. The regularities of the influence of structural, physicochemical, acid-base and mass-exchange characteristics of the obtained materials on their activity in the processes of heterogeneous-catalytic conversion of carbohydrates, carbon monoxide and alcohols will be established. popup.nrat_date 2024-12-10 Close
